"/$data{name}"; my $key = $self->file_to_hash( $data{file} ); return { url => $key->{url}, login => $key->{login}, salt => $key->{salt}, }; } 1; __END__ =head1 NAME App::Raps2 - A Password safe =head1 SYNOPSIS use App::Raps2; my $raps2 = App::Raps2->new(); =head1 DESCRIPTION B is the backend for B, a simple commandline password safe. =head1 VERSION This manual documents App::Raps2 version 0.50 =head1 METHODS =over =item $raps2 = App::Raps2->new( I<%conf> ) Returns a new B object. Accepted configuration parameters are: =over =item B => I B of key setup, passed on to App::Raps2::Password(3pm). =item B => I If set to true, App::Raps2 assumes it will not be used as a CLI. It won't initialize its Term::ReadLine object and won't try to read anything from the terminal. =back =item $raps2->get_master_password( [I<$password>] ) Sets the master password used to encrypt all accounts. Uses I if specified, otherwise it asks the user via App::Raps2::UI(3pm). =item $raps2->pw_load( B => I | B => I ) Load a password from I (or account I), requires B to have been called before. Returns a hashref containing its url, login, salt and decrypted password and extra. =item $raps2->pw_load_info( B => I | B => I ) Load all unencrypted data from I (or account I). Unlike B, this method does not require a prior call to B. Returns a hashref with url, login and salt. =item $raps2->pw_save( I<%data> ) Write an account as specified by I to the store. Requires B to have been called before. The following I keys are supported: =over =item B => I (mandatory) =item B => I =item B => I | B => I (one must be set) =item B => I (optional) =item B => I (optional) =item B => I (optiona) =back =item $raps2->ui() Returns the App::Raps2::UI(3pm) object. =back =head2 INTERNAL You usually don't need to call these methods by yourself. =over =item $raps2->create_config() Creates a default config and asks the user to set a master password. =item $raps2->load_config() Load config. Automatically called by B. =item $raps2->pw() Returns the App::Raps2::Password(3pm) object. =item $raps2->file_to_hash( I<$file> ) Reads $file (lines with key/value separated by whitespace) and returns a hashref with its key/value pairs. =item $raps2->sanity_check() Create working directories (~/.config/raps2 and ~/.local/share/raps2, or the respective XDG environment variable contents), if they don't exist yet. Automatically called by B. Calls B if no raps2 config was found. =back =head1 DIAGNOSTICS If anything goes wrong, B will die with a backtrace (using B from Carp(3pm)). =head1 DEPENDENCIES App::Raps2::Password(3pm), App::Raps2::UI(3pm), File::BaseDir(3pm), File::Slurp(3pm). =head1 BUGS AND LIMITATIONS Be aware that the password handling API is not yet stable. =head1 AUTHOR Copyright (C) 2011 by Daniel Friesel Ederf@finalrewind.orgE =head1 LICENSE 0.
